      Add hidden options --extra-front-end-options and --extra-gen-snapshot-options to flutter tool (#12219)
      
      This CL introduces 2 hidden options to 'flutter build aot' and 'flutter run' for passing arbitrary arguments to front-end server and to gen_snapshot tool when building and running flutter app in --profile or --release modes.
      
      The ability to pass arbitrary options simplifies various experiments, as it removes the need to change defaults and rebuild flutter engine for every tested configuration.

      Deep linking: automatically push the route hiearchy on load. (#10894) · 9adb4a78
      Ian Hickson authored
      The main purpose of this PR is to make it so that when you set the
      initial route and it's a hierarchical route (e.g. `/a/b/c`), it
      implies multiple pushes, one for each step of the route (so in that
      case, `/`, `/a`, `/a/b`, and `/a/b/c`, in that order). If any of those
      routes don't exist, it falls back to '/'.
      
      As part of doing that, I:
      
       * Changed the default for MaterialApp.initialRoute to honor the
         actual initial route.
      
       * Added a MaterialApp.onUnknownRoute for handling bad routes.
      
       * Added a feature to flutter_driver that allows the host test script
         and the device test app to communicate.
      
       * Added a test to make sure `flutter drive --route` works.
         (Hopefully that will also prove `flutter run --route` works, though
         this isn't testing the `flutter` tool's side of that. My main
         concern is over whether the engine side works.)
      
       * Fixed `flutter drive` to output the right target file name.
      
       * Changed how the stocks app represents its data, so that we can
         show a page for a stock before we know if it exists.
      
       * Made it possible to show a stock page that doesn't exist. It shows
         a progress indicator if we're loading the data, or else shows a
         message saying it doesn't exist.
      
       * Changed the pathing structure of routes in stocks to work more
         sanely.
      
       * Made search in the stocks app actually work (before it only worked
         if we happened to accidentally trigger a rebuild). Added a test.
      
       * Replaced some custom code in the stocks app with a BackButton.
      
       * Added a "color" feature to BackButton to support the stocks use case.
      
       * Spaced out the ErrorWidget text a bit more.
      
       * Added `RouteSettings.copyWith`, which I ended up not using.
      
       * Improved the error messages around routing.
      
      While I was in some files I made a few formatting fixes, fixed some
      code health issues, and also removed `flaky: true` from some devicelab
      tests that have been stable for a while. Also added some documentation
      here and there.

      Switch many `Device` methods to be async (#9587) · 60c5ffc1
      Todd Volkert authored
      `adb` can sometimes hang, which will in turn hang the Dart isolate if
      we're using `Process.runSync()`. This changes many of the `Device` methods
      to return `Future<T>` in order to allow them to use the async process
      methods. A future change will add timeouts to the associated calls so
      that we can properly alert the user to the hung `adb` process.
      
      This is work towards #7102, #9567

      Update flutter_tools to use package:file throughout (#7385) · 8bb27034
      Todd Volkert authored
      This removes direct file access from within flutter_tools
      in favor of using `package:file` via a `FileSystem` that's
      accessed via the `ApplicationContext`.
      
      This lays the groundwork for us to be able to easily swap
      out the underlying file system when running Flutter tools,
      which will be used to provide a record/replay file system,
      analogous to what we have for process invocations.
